I have implemented quite a few HR software's for various companies, they are not specific appraisal systems but cover the whole HR Function, (i.e absence management, employee relations, recruitment, policies, reporting, appraisals etc.) The appraisal aspect of the system caters for all that you have requested above, obviously if you want the appraisal to work in line with competencies/capability frameworks, then there will be a high level of HR Input into the system to creates a seamless workflow.
I am currently in the process of implementing You Manage HR - software , I am finding this a very comprehensive HR System and so that requires a lot of input from the HR Dept, I do feel this software is not as user friendly as some I have used but it covers everything and all your HR processes can be managed electronically.
Other softwares I have used which have the on-line appraisal element are:
PeopleHR
BreatheHR
Not sure what you have in place already or if a full HR Software system would be a consideration for you - but it is all I can advise on personally.
